North East Maryland, at the top of the Chesapeake, hosted the FLW College Fishing Northern Conference Invitational this weekend. The boys from West Virginia University took home the title and qualified for the 2014 Collegiate Fishing National Championships.
The team of Edward Rude III of Falling Waters, W. Va and Mathew Gibson of Morgantown, W. Va, won with thier two day eight bass limit totalling to 19 pounds 3 ounces. Earning their club $4,000
"I went out almost every weekend prior to the tournament," said Rude. "All I learned in practice was that I couldn't catch fish in the Chesapeake Bay."
Rude said that it wasn't until the tournament started that the pair began to figure out the intricacies of fishing on the Bay.
“On the first day we idled out about a quarter mile and started on the first dock on the right and just went down the bank junk fishing,” he said. “We started putting pieces of the puzzle together and caught a couple off docks and a couple on a crankbait.
